Hero image home@2x

如何在 Visual Studio Code 中高效实现代码纠错

如何在 Visual Studio Code 中高效实现代码纠错

在使用 Visual Studio Code(VSCode)进行开发时,代码纠错是非常重要的一环。VSCode 提供了多种集成的工具和扩展来帮助开发者快速定位和修复错误。本文将指导你如何配置 VSCode,以便在代码中自动检测错误,并提供相应的解决方案。

准备工作

在开始之前,请确保你已经安装了 Visual Studio Code,并根据你的编程语言安装了相应的扩展(如 Python、JavaScript 等)。以下是你需要的准备步骤:

  • 下载并安装 VSCode:你可以从 https://code.visualstudio.com/ 下载最新版本。
  • 安装并启动 VSCode。
  • 根据你的编程语言,搜索并安装相应的扩展。例如,Python 用户可以安装 Python 扩展。

代码纠错配置步骤

一旦你完成了准备工作,接下来就是配置 VSCode 以提高代码纠错的能力。

1. 安装必要的扩展

一些编程语言的扩展可能会集成 linting 和语法检查功能。以下是安装扩展的步骤:

  1. 打开 VSCode,点击左侧活动栏中的扩展图标(或使用快捷键 Ctrl + Shift + X)。
  2. 在搜索框中输入你的编程语言,例如 PythonESLint
  3. 找到相应的扩展并点击安装

2. 配置 ESLint(以 JavaScript 为例)

对于 JavaScript 项目,通常使用 ESLint 进行代码纠错。以下是配置 ESLint 的步骤:

  1. 在终端中导航到你的项目目录,运行以下命令以安装 ESLint:
  2. npm install eslint --save-dev

  3. 然后初始化 ESLint 配置:
  4. npx eslint --init

  5. 根据提示选择配置选项,并生成一个 .eslintrc.js 文件。

3. 启用自动保存和问题警告

设置 VSCode 以便在保存文件时自动检查错误,并在代码中突出显示问题:

  1. 打开设置界面(Ctrl + ,),搜索Auto Save并将其设置为 afterDelay
  2. 在设置中搜索Linting,确保相关语言的 linting 功能被启用。

关键命令和概念解释

以下是你在配置过程中可能使用到的一些关键命令或概念:

  • npm install:用于安装 Node.js 模块。这个命令会将依赖模块安装到 node_modules 目录。
  • npx:这是 npm 包的执行命令,可以直接运行包中的命令,而无需全局安装。
  • .eslintrc.js:这是 ESLint 的配置文件,用于定义 linting 规则。

可能遇到的问题与实用技巧

在配置 VSCode 进行代码纠错时,你可能会遇到一些常见问题:

  • ESLint 报告错误但不突出显示:确保你在项目中正确安装了 ESLint,并且 VSCode 中的 linting 功能已启用。
  • VSCode 无法找到模块:确保在你的项目中安装了所有必要的依赖项。如果你在工作区以外的地方打开项目,可能会遇到此问题。

实用技巧:定期更新你的扩展及其配置文件,保持它们的最新状态,这样可以享受到最新的功能和修复。

通过以上步骤配置 Visual Studio Code,可以大幅提升代码纠错的效率,让你在编程中更加高效和精确。希望这篇文章能够帮助你快速上手!